Emily & Jenner

We never get tired of working at this private club in Downtown Charleston overlooking the Harbor. It is such a blank canvas to create all looks and styles for weddings and events alike.

This bride had such a fun and unique style. Playful and feminine, with low country influence, there were several iconic elements used to really make it stand out from anything else we have created in this space. A wall of flower stems that appear to be floating behind the cake, made a great statement and photographic opportunity towards the end of the night. A low boxwood hedge to dress up the stage displayed the bride and groom’s monogram in rose heads, and our new favorite light fixtures, created with strands of oyster shells and bronze trim. We love these photos by Anne Rhett Photography beautifully capturing the details, not to mention the gorgeous bride smiling ear to ear the entire night.

Tiffany & Frank – Intimate Charleston Wedding {part 2}

After a casual, creek side rehearsal dinner, an elegant, garden affair was the perfect atmosphere for Tiffany & Frank’s intimate Charleston wedding. They chose the lawn of the Governor Thomas Bennett House. Following the ceremony, the guests enjoyed a dinner beneath the stars, as the couple arranged for a 7 course tasting menu to be served to guests al fresco, in the property’s “grotto.” Lights, glass beads, and chandeliers were strung from the willow branches above the dining table, and with the Bob Williams Duo stroking the violin, Chef and Restaurateur, Bob Carter came out to present each course to the guests, explaining the preparation of each selection. The menu follows.

 

While guests were enjoying their meal, to their surprise, the bride and groom had planned a performance by the Voices of Deliverance Gullah Singers. The singers came dancing and singing into the garden grotto, dressed colorful, traditional Gullah attire, and serenaded the bride and groom and their guests with joyful soul and gospel songs.
